phenanthro[9,10-b]quinoline
Also Known As: Dibenz[a,c]acridine, Dibenzo[a,c]acridine, Dibenzacridine, Dibenzo(a,c)acridine, DIBENZ(A,C)ACRIDINE

| Molecular Formula | C21H13N |
| Molecular Weight | 279.1048 g/mol |
| XLogP | 5.7 |
| Topological Polar Surface Area (TPSA) | 12.9 Ų |
| Hydrogen Bond Donors | 0 |
| Hydrogen Bond Acceptors | 1 |
| Rotatable Bonds | 0 |
| Exact Mass | 279.1048 Da |
| Heavy Atoms | 22 |
| Complexity | 405.0 |
| SMILES | C1=CC=C2C(=C1)C=C3C4=CC=CC=C4C5=CC=CC=C5C3=N2 |
| InChIKey | GUZBPGZOTDAWBO-UHFFFAOYSA-N |

The XLogP value of 5.7 indicates that Dibenz(a,c)acridine is lipophilic (fat-soluble), which may influence its absorption, distribution, and formulation strategy. With a topological polar surface area (TPSA) of 12.9 Ų, Dibenz(a,c)acridine ex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, Dibenz(a,c)acridine has 0 hydrogen bond donor(s) and 1 hydrogen bond acceptor(s), which may warrant consideration for formulation optimization.
